The South London duo channel Phoenix and TDCC on their jovial new single “Early Hours”.
Whilst certainly not groundbreaking New Cross group WOWH are making a really quite charming blend of indie and soulful groove that seems to be striking a chord. Their latest endeavor “Early Hours” is a marriage of disco funk and an almost Alt-j-esque vocal in places. Certainly a toe tapper.

The lyrical content, in singer Nick Harrison’s words, is “about booty calls and I suppose it was meant to reflect on how healthy they are for the people involved.”
“Early Hours” is out now.
